Beef 'N' Broccoli Stir-Fry Recipe
  • Prep/Total Time: 30 min.
  • Yield: 4 Servings
10 20 30

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up thinly sliced onion
  • 2 tablespoons chopped green onion
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 teaspoons olive oil
  • 1 pound beef top sirloin steak, cut into thin strips
  • 1/3 cup white wine or beef broth
  • 3 cups broccoli florets
  • 2 cups sliced fresh mushrooms
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• 1/8 teaspoon pepper
  • 1 cup beef broth
  • 2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
  • Hot cooked rice, optional

Directions

  • In a large nonstick skillet or wok, stir-fry the onion, green onion and garlic in oil over low heat until tender. Add beef; stir-fry over medium heat for 5-7 minutes or until meat is no longer pink and onions are golden. Using a slotted spoon, remove meat and onions; set aside.
  • Add wine or broth to the pan; stir to loosen browned bits. Add broccoli and mushrooms; stir-fry over high heat until broccoli is tender. In a bowl, combine cornstarch and pepper; stir in broth and vinegar until smooth. Add to the pan.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Stir in beef and onions; heat through. Serve over rice if desired. Yield: 4 servings.

Nutritional Analysis: One serving (1 cup beef mixture, calculated without rice) equals 248 calories, 9 g fat (3 g saturated fat), 67 mg cholesterol, 297 mg sodium, 11 g carbohydrate, 2 g fiber, 28 g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 3 lean meat, 2 vegetable, 1/2 fat.

Full-Bodied White Wine

Enjoy this recipe with a full-bodied white wine such as Chardonnay or Viognier.
